Output ee90626dc7049844962881c9d3cb11dc7c6a8b6fc4fd283324314d734383006f:2

value
63636578
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b9daebef4851ea0dac3bc2fb8b20efa395c7eab1 OP_EQUAL
address
3JdjByQ6Nu7TqrtF7bC8cksy63sZqfRd2c
transaction
ee90626dc7049844962881c9d3cb11dc7c6a8b6fc4fd283324314d734383006f
spent
true